More about Mental Health courses
Are you looking to embark on a rewarding journey into the Mental Health field in Gateshead? With various courses available, you can find the perfect fit for your level of experience. For those new to the industry, consider enrolling in courses such as the Certificate III in Community Services CHC32015, Assist Clients with Medication Skill Set CHCSS00070, or Work in a Recovery Context PUARCV003. These beginner courses will provide you with essential skills and knowledge, preparing you for a successful career in Mental Health.
If you have prior experience or qualifications, you might be interested in our advanced courses available in Gateshead. The Certificate IV in Mental Health CHC43315 is a fantastic option for those looking to deepen their expertise. Additionally, consider pursuing a Bachelor of Psychological Science or a Bachelor of Psychological Science (Honours). These programmes are designed to elevate your knowledge and professional capabilities in the Mental Health sector.
In Gateshead, you have access to several reputable training providers dedicated to delivering high-quality Mental Health education. Local providers include the Transformational Institute, which offers the Certificate IV in Mental Health, and the Wesley Vocational Institute. Additionally, the University of Newcastle (UON) and ACIMS, which teaches the Work in a Recovery Context, are also excellent choices for students wishing to study face to face.
It’s important to know that the Mental Health field encompasses various study areas that might pique your interest. You can explore courses related to Case Management, Alcohol and Other Drugs, Child Welfare, Youth and Family Intervention, and much more.
